Ingredients: The Heart of Your Skillet

  • 2.4 lbs russet potatoes, peeled and diced into approximately ½-inch cubes. Russet potatoes are an excellent choice for this skillet due to their high starch content, which allows them to become wonderfully tender and fluffy, absorbing the rich enchilada sauce beautifully during simmering.
  • 1 cup peppers and onions, finely chopped. A colorful mix of bell peppers (green, red, or yellow) combined with a yellow onion adds essential aromatics, a touch of sweetness, and vibrant color to the dish. For ultimate convenience, pre-chopped frozen mixes work perfectly.
  • 5 oz can chicken, drained. Canned chicken is a fantastic pantry staple for quick meals, providing a lean protein source without any additional cooking time. If you prefer, you can substitute with about 1 cup of shredded cooked rotisserie chicken or any leftover cooked chicken breast.
  • 10 oz can red enchilada sauce. Select your favorite brand of red enchilada sauce to establish a robust and authentic Tex-Mex flavor profile. Both mild and medium heat levels work wonderfully, depending on your spice preference.
  • ½ cup water. Adding water helps to slightly thin the enchilada sauce, ensuring that the potatoes cook thoroughly and evenly without the dish becoming too dry. It also contributes to the simmering process, creating a perfectly cooked consistency.
  • 1 tbsp taco seasoning. A high-quality taco seasoning blend is absolutely crucial for infusing the potatoes and chicken with that classic, irresistible Tex-Mex flavor. Feel free to adjust the amount based on your personal preference for spice and seasoning intensity.
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ar or Mexican blend cheese. (Optional, for topping) While optional, adding cheese at the end provides a delicious, melty, and incredibly satisfying finish that enhances the overall richness of the skillet.

Step-by-Step Instructions: Creating Your Skillet Masterpiece

  • Step 1: Combine All Ingredients. Begin by taking a large, deep skillet or a sturdy Dutch oven and placing it on your stove over medium-low heat. Add all of the prepared ingredients into the pan: the diced russet potatoes, the chopped peppers and onions, the well-drained canned chicken, the entire can of red enchilada sauce, the ½ cup of water, and the tablespoon of taco seasoning. Using a large spoon or spatula, give all the ingredients a thorough stir. Ensure that the potatoes and chicken are completely coated with the flavorful sauce and seasoning blend. This initial mixing is key for an even distribution of taste throughout the entire dish.
  • Step 2: Simmer to Perfection. Once everything is well combined, cover the skillet tightly with a lid. This crucial step creates a steaming environment that will cook the diced potatoes evenly and tenderize them beautifully. Allow the mixture to simmer gently for approximately 15 minutes. During this simmering period, remember to stir the contents occasionally (every 3-5 minutes) to prevent any sticking to the bottom of the pan and to ensure that all the potatoes are submerged in the sauce for consistent cooking. The objective here is to achieve fork-tender potatoes. If you notice the sauce reducing too quickly or becoming too thick, feel free to add an extra tablespoon or two of water to maintain the desired consistency.
  • Step 3: Add Cheese and Serve. After the 15-minute simmering period, or once the potatoes are perfectly tender when pierced with a fork, your Enchilada Potato Skillet is almost ready to be enjoyed! If you’ve chosen to add cheese, now is the time to generously sprinkle about 1 cup of shredded cheddar or a Mexican blend cheese evenly over the top of the hot mixture. Replace the lid for just a minute or two, allowing the residual heat to melt the cheese until it’s beautifully gooey and bubbly. Once melted, remove from heat and prepare to serve.

Serving Suggestions and Customization

While this Enchilada Potato Skillet is hearty and delicious enough to stand on its own, you can easily elevate it with your favorite Tex-Mex toppings and complementary side dishes. Here are some ideas to make each serving even more special and personalized:

  • Fresh and Creamy Toppings: A generous dollop of cool sour cream or a healthier Greek yogurt, a sprinkle of fresh, vibrant cilantro, diced avocado or a spoonful of homemade guacamole, sliced green onions, or a refreshing squeeze of fresh lime juice will add layers of brightness and delightful texture.
  • Amplify the Heat: For those who love a spicy kick, consider adding some thinly sliced jalapeños (either fresh or pickled), a dash of your favorite hot sauce, or a pinch of red pepper flakes stirred into the mix before simmering.
  • Boost the Veggies: Enhance the nutritional value and texture by stirring in a can of drained corn or black beans during the last few minutes of cooking. This adds more fiber and flavor.
  • Perfect Pairings: Serve this satisfying skillet with a simple green salad dressed with a light vinaigrette to balance the richness, or alongside warm flour or corn tortillas for scooping up all the deliciousness.
